The 2D:4D Ratio — What Science Actually Says

Researchers use something called the 2D:4D ratio, which compares:

2D = index finger

4D = ring finger

This ratio is thought to be influenced by exposure to certain hormones (like testosterone and estrogen) in the womb.

Some studies have explored links between a longer ring finger and traits such as:

Competitiveness

Risk tolerance

Spatial ability

Athletic performance

However — and this is important — these are statistical tendencies, not personality guarantees. The effects are small and not reliable predictors of character, morality, destiny, or emotional depth.

There is no scientific evidence that finger length reveals:

A “soul contract”

Unfinished past-life missions

Greater integrity or empathy

A harder life path

Those ideas are symbolic, not biological.
